    Yes it was another awesome Taupo trackday. Very well run, even when things didn't go to plan. They had a prize draw at lunchtime and a lucky prepaying customer went home with a pair of new Dual Compound Pirelli Diablo Corsa 3 tyres worth around $700. Two others won free trackdays and one a special T-shirt.

    Our adventure began when four of us left Auckland after 6pm and after various delays had to ride from Tokoroa to Taupo in the dark, rain and a reasonable amount of traffic. No fun, and even less for Ninjaboy, who only had a dark visor, so followed my taillight.

    The trackday itself was the usual adrenaline rush though I struggled a bit with tyres. I was happy to pass Aff-man in the first session, as that will be the last time I pass him!!
